Adding Onto Their List Of Chores

A boy washing dishes
A boy washing dishes
When kids misbehave, give them something more, like more duties, rather than taking something away from them. My junior in high school has to clean a room in the house every time he forgets to do the dishes. I can see the frustration in his eyes when I tell him he neglected to wash the dishes when I wake him up from school on some mornings.
He knows he has to clean one of the rooms when he gets back from school without even saying anything. Children enjoy being lazy, so they will go to great lengths to avoid having to complete extra tasks. Instead of using this tactic as a punishment, you may also use it as a deterrence. For instance, my son is aware that he must clean a room each time he forgets to do the dishes. He's only neglected to clean the dishes twice since I put this rule into place. He used to forget a few times a week before that.

Making Them Walk Home From School

A child going to school
A child going to school
Naturally, you have to live quite close to their school for this to work. A ride to and from school is a luxury, not a need, for the majority of pupils. Simply inform them they would have to walk home for a week if they misbehave.
They get to be more active for the week, while you get to stay at home. Furthermore, since nobody their age enjoys taking a lengthy walk after a demanding school day, kids are less likely to commit the same offense again. Make sure they just need to walk back from school; if you force them to walk there every day, you can be sure they won't make it to first period on time.

Creative Punishments For High School Students - FAQs

What Is A Positive Punishment?

When you give an unpleasant behavior a consequence, that is known as positive punishment. This is what you do to detract from its appeal. Increasing the amount of duties your child has to complete after they ignore their obligations is an example of positive punishment.

How Can Creative Punishments Address Disruptive Behavior In The Classroom?

Instead of traditional punishment, try assigning a reflective essay on the impact of disruptive behavior. You could also empower the student to organize and lead a class discussion on appropriate behavior, fostering a sense of responsibility.

Are There Creative Ways To Handle Tardiness Or Skipping Class?

For tardiness, consider implementing a "creative arrival" policy where late students contribute something creative (e.g., a joke or poem) to enter the class. To address skipping, you might assign a special project or presentation on the importance of punctuality.
